651 Hale Avenue North Oakdale, Minnesota 55128 telephone: 651.710.8448 facsimile: 651.710.2552 www.eorinc.com <br />Date I May 18, 2011 <br />To I GLWMO Board of Commissioners <br />cc I Tom Petersen, GLWMO Administrator <br />Duane Schwartz, City of Roseville <br />Mark Maloney, City of Shoreview <br />From I Camilla Correll <br />Regarding I GLWMO Internal Comments on DRAFT Watershed Management Plan <br />Background <br />On May 6, 2011 FOR delivered copies of the DRAFT Watershed Management Plan to Karen Eckman <br />Tom Petersen Duane Schwartz and Mark Maloney. Copies of the watershed management plan were <br />provided to the Jonathan Miller and Mary Kay Von De Linder the following week and copies were <br />provided to Chuck Westerberg and the new Commissioner earlier this week. <br />In the transmittal with the DRAFT Watershed Management Plan FOR requested that comments be <br />received by May 18, 2011 so that they could be summarized in a memo to the Board for review at the <br />May 19, 2011 Board Meeting. <br />Update <br />To date, FOR has received comments from the following individuals: Karen Eckman Jonathan Miller, <br />Tom Petersen and Duane Schwartz. The comments are reflected below. At this point the comments <br />appear to be minor in nature (no conflicting comments) and will be incorporated at one time once all <br />internal comments have been submitted to FOR. <br />Comments Received as of May 18, 2011 <br />Comments are grouped by plan section and the initials of the individual submitting the comment are <br />provided with the comment. <br />General Comments <br />Comment (JM) As a general comment, some sections use footnote references, while some use scientific <br />parenthetic notation. It would be nice if there was a unified reference format through the <br />document (as this is not a scientific document, I would prefer footnotes as they do not <br />]rider reading as much). <br />Response This change will be made to the plan <br />Acknowledeements <br />Comment (KE) Organize the stakeholders as follows: group them by agency, non - profits, and residents <br />(alphabetical by city). <br />Response This change will be made to the plan <br />An Equal Opportunity Affirmative Action Employer <br />Emmons & Olivier Resources, Inc. water I ecology I community <br />
